12962. What Are You Doing For Jesus?

1 What are you doing for Jesus,
Since He redeemed you from sin?
Gladly fulfilling your promise,
Souls for the kingdom to win?

Refrain:
What are you doing for Jesus?
Thoughtfully ponder it o’er;
Could you with joy at His coming
To Him each talent restore?

2 What are you doing for Jesus?
Letting your light shine for Him shine?
Seeking to honor the Father?
Heeding each precept divine? [Refrain]

3 What are you doing for Jesus?
Idling the moments away?
Yielding to every temptation?
Even forgetting to pray? [Refrain]

4 What are you doing for Jesus?
Now every promise renew,
And till He calls you to Heaven,
Ever be loyal and true. [Refrain]

Text Information
First Line: What are you doing for Jesus
Title: What Are You Doing For Jesus?
Author: Sylvia Lee (1918)
Refrain First Line: What are you doing for Jesus?
Meter: 87.87 D
Language: English
Source: Songs of Love (Athens, GA: Athens Music Company, 1925)
Copyright: Public Domain
Tune Information
Name: SINŬIJU
Composer: James Houston Smith
Meter: 87.87 D
Key: B♭ Major
Copyright: Public Domain
